Where is Abbey Hulton?
Where is Abbey Hulton located?
Abbey Hulton, Abbey Hulton, Great Britain (approx. 53.03532°, -2.1322527°)
Where is Abbey Hulton on the map?
{"latitude":53.03532,"longitude":-2.1322527,"title":"Abbey Hulton"}